- Jan harvey LisingJul 02, 2025 · 22 days agoWhen comparing commission fees for different cryptocurrency platforms, there are several factors that should be considered. Firstly, you should look at the fee structure of each platform. Some platforms charge a flat fee per transaction, while others charge a percentage of the transaction amount. Secondly, consider the volume of your trades. Some platforms offer lower fees for high-volume traders, while others have tiered fee structures based on trading volume. Thirdly, take into account any additional fees or charges, such as withdrawal fees or deposit fees. Lastly, consider the reputation and reliability of the platform. It's important to choose a platform that has a good track record and is known for its security and customer support.
